Mission

Institute of Public Strategies (IPS) is a nonprofit corporation that receives its funding from local and federal governmental agencies and private foundations, through long-term grants or contracts to provide community-level services within specified regions or communities. IPS helps community partners prevent problems by focusing on the community conditions (the social determinants of health) that negatively influence population-level health outcomes.IPS vision is safe, secure, vibrant, and healthy communities where everyone can thrive. The mission of IPS is to work alongside communities to build power, challenge systems of injustice, protect health, and improve quality of life.
